Fremantle youngster Chris Mayne has signed on with the Dockers until the end of the 2010 season.
Mayne has only played three games since being drafted last year at selection No.40.
He now joins Rhys Palmer and Clayton Hinkley as fellow Fremantle up-and-comers who have been locked away until the end of 2010.
The 19-year-old has averaged 11 possessions a match in the three games he has played since debuting in Round 2 against Hawthorn.
